Pryde first turned heads in 1999 when he came from out of nowhere to run away with the first prize in the Just for Laughs Comedy Night in Canada Competition. Soon after, he was nominated for a Canadian Comedy Award as Funniest New Comedian in Canada. Since then he has performed in shows all over Canada, the U.S., and the U.K. He has written for Open Mike with Mike Bullard and This Hour has 22 Minutes; joined the award-winning On the Spot Improv Troupe and amassed a ton of TV and radio credits. These include performances at the Halifax Comedy Festival, Madly Off in All Directions, two galas from the Just for Laughs Festival, and his own special on CTV's Comedy Now. He's done a lot in a relatively short career and shows no signs of slowing down.
